How Magic Card Values Are Determined

Key determinants include card condition and grading, rarity, Reserved List status, and format popularity. Cards with strong tournament play presence or Commander demand generally retain good value. Price trends and recent sales influence what sellers can expect, requiring awareness of the current market state.

Tips Before Selling Your Magic: The Gathering Collection

  • Isolate Reserved List cards and Commander staples for targeted offers.
  • Organize singles by condition and current price guides.
  • Identify and showcase graded cards appropriately.
  • Consult recent sales data to verify price expectations.
  • Store valuable cards safely to avoid damage before sale.
  • Balance cash offers with potential online sale values.
  • Secure multiple opinions on larger collections for best results.

What Magic cards are worth the most?

Top-valued cards include Black Lotus, Moxen, Time Walk, dual lands, Reserved List, and graded or sealed cards.

Are Reserved List cards valuable?

Yes, collectors prize Reserved List cards highly due to their print limitations.

Can I sell an entire MTG collection?

Absolutely, with better value often achieved by organizing key cards separately.

Should I grade valuable Magic cards before selling?

Grading can enhance buyer confidence and value, particularly for rare or high-end cards.
